Karl Fuchs growth & trailing leader

It would be very helpful if someone could describe how to manage the 'trailing' leader of Cedrus deodara?
I bought a 4' tall tightly staked C. deodara 'Karl Fuchs' this spring. I've now loosely staked and the 1 yr old growth now arches over.

Does the current season growth straighten up as it hardens off in Fall so the terminal bud is starting at the highest point?

OR

Does C. deodara develop a new leader every year at the point where the previous year's growth starts to arch over?

Do I need to train the 1yr old growth into a vertical position before the current season's growth gets going? Will I always have to do this?

In contrast, my C. libani var. stenocoma is going to make an excellent telephone pole.
